When a business ERP is distributed among multiple databases, it's not uncommon to encounter "orphaned" data that doesn't fit into a particular data set.
Separation of Departmental Systems
Isolated departmental systems often lead to data redundancies. For a business to have efficient management of storage and processing systems, data redundancy is a symptom of bad architecture.
Complicated Interactions
One of the most substantial challenges businesses that deal with ERPs face is getting their chosen ERP solution to work with their other systems.
Scalability Issues
Some ERP solutions are designed for use with small businesses, but their use hobbles the company's development as the enterprise grows.
